Herb Sutter es un destacado experto en C ++ . También es autor de libros y columnista del Dr. Dobb's Journal . Se unió a Microsoft en 2002 como un evangelista de plataforma para Visual C ++ .NET , llegando a ser el arquitecto líder de software para C ++ / CLI . [1] Sutter se ha desempeñado como secretario y coordinador del comité de normas ISO C ++ durante más de 10 años. En septiembre de 2008 fue reemplazado por PJ Plauger . Luego volvió a asumir el puesto de convocante, [2] después de que Plauger renunciara en octubre de 2009. [3] [4] En los últimos años, Sutter fue diseñador principal deC ++ / CX y C ++ AMP . [5]
Educación y carrera
Sutter nació y se crió en Oakville, Ontario , antes de estudiar informática en la Universidad de Waterloo de Canadá . [6]
De 1995 a 2001 fue director de tecnología en PeerDirect, donde diseñó el motor de replicación de la base de datos PeerDirect. [6]
Gurú de la semana
De 1997 a 2003, Sutter creó regularmente problemas de programación en C ++ y los publicó en el grupo de noticias de Usenet comp.lang.c ++. Moderado, bajo el título Gurú de la semana . Los problemas generalmente abordaban conceptos erróneos comunes o conceptos poco entendidos en C ++. Sutter publicó más tarde versiones ampliadas de muchos de los problemas en sus dos primeros libros, Exceptional C ++ y More Exceptional C ++ . Desde noviembre de 2011 se publicaron nuevos artículos, en su mayoría relacionados con C ++ 11. [7]
Se acabó el almuerzo gratis
"The Free Lunch Is Over" es un artículo [8] de Herb Sutter publicado en 2005. Afirmaba que la velocidad de procesamiento en serie del microprocesador está alcanzando un límite físico, lo que tiene dos consecuencias principales:
- Los fabricantes de procesadores se centrarán en productos que admitan mejor el subproceso múltiple (como los procesadores de varios núcleos) y
- Los desarrolladores de software se verán obligados a desarrollar programas de múltiples subprocesos masivos como una forma de utilizar mejor dichos procesadores.
Bibliografía
- C ++ excepcional ( Addison-Wesley , 2000, ISBN 0-201-61562-2 )
- C ++ más excepcional ( Addison-Wesley , 2002, ISBN 0-201-70434-X )
- Excepcional estilo C ++ ( Addison-Wesley , 2005, ISBN 0-201-76042-8 )
- Estándares de codificación C ++ (junto con Andrei Alexandrescu , Addison-Wesley , 2005, ISBN 0-321-11358-6 )
Referencias
- ^ Sutter, Herb (1 de abril de 2004). "Informe de viaje: octubre-diciembre de 2003" . Diario del Dr. Dobb . Consultado el 21 de mayo de 2009 .
- ^ Herb Sutter (3 de marzo de 2010). "¿Dónde puede obtener el estándar ISO C ++ y qué significa" estándar abierto "?" . Molino de Sutter . Consultado el 16 de octubre de 2011 .
- ^ Stefanus Du Toit (4 de diciembre de 2009). Acta de la reunión del GT21, 19 de octubre de 2009 (PDF) . Estándares abiertos (Informe). págs. 10, 20-21 . Consultado el 10 de abril de 2010 .
- ^ George Ryan; Ville Voutilainen; Francis Glassborow; Steve Clamage (25 de octubre de 2009). "¿Plauger renunció como convocante?" . comp.std.c ++ (lista de correo) . Consultado el 22 de mayo de 2020 .
- ^ "Acerca de" . Consultado el 30 de octubre de 2012 .
- ^ a b "Miembros del WG21 (Comité ISO C ++)" . isocpp.org .
- ^ Categoría GotW del blog de Sutter
- ^ Sutter, H. (2005). "Se acabó el almuerzo gratis: un giro fundamental hacia la concurrencia en el software" . Diario del Dr. Dobb . Vol. 30 no. 3.
enlaces externos
Medios relacionados con Herb Sutter en Wikimedia Commons
- Página web oficial